La repetició d'un mapa hash es fa quan el nombre d'elements del mapa arriba al valor de llindar màxim. Quan es produeix una repetició, es podria utilitzar una nova funció hash o fins i tot la mateixa funció hash, però els compartiments en què es troben els valors podrien canviar.
Què és el refs, posa un exemple?
El repetit és una tècnica de en la qual es canvia la mida de la taula, és a dir, la mida de la taula es duplica mitjançant la creació d'una taula nova. És preferible que la mida total de la taula sigui un nombre primer. Hi ha situacions en què es requereix el refs. • Quan la taula està completament plena.
El repetit i el doble hashing són iguals?
Hash doble o repetició: repetiu la tecla una segona vegada, utilitzant una funció hash diferent i utilitzeu el resultat com a mida del pas. Per a una clau determinada, la mida del pas es manté constant al llarg d'una sonda, però és diferent per a diferents claus. … La funció hash doble requereix que la mida de la taula hash sigui un nombre primer.
Com augmenta la mida el mapa hash?
Tan aviat com el 13th element (parell clau-valor) aparegui al mapa Hash, augmentarà la seva mida des del valor predeterminat 24=16 galledes a 25=32 galledes. Una altra manera de calcular la mida: quan la relació del factor de càrrega (m/n) arriba a 0,75 a en aquest moment, hashmap augmenta la seva capacitat.
Què és el factor de càrrega de la taula hash?
El factor de càrrega és una mesura de com es permet que la taula hash estigui plena abans que la seva capacitat s'augmenti automàticament.